Livingston County church vandalized twice in 3 days

A church in Howell was vandalized on Feb. 19 and Feb. 22, 2019. (WDIV)

HOWELL, Mich. – Over the course of a few days, a Livingston County church was vandalized twice.

According to a Facebook post, the St. John the Baptist Catholic Church on Hacker Road in Howell, just north of M-59, was vandalized late Tuesday night. Another Facebook post from the church claims more vandalism occurred just before 1 a.m. Friday.

The church said surveillance video from Friday's incident showed a slender man between 5 feet, 9 inches and 6 feet tall deface a wall on the church. He is said to be driving a subcompact car. 

Livingston County Sheriff's Office is investigating the incident.
